A (probably failed) attempt to find fluorescence in the Sol 935 MAHLI night shots:
Starting from this Sol 935 MAHLI white LED night shot, RGB channel-wise histo stretch returned this image: ![]() Starting from this Sol 935 MAHLI uv LED night shot, perliminary cleaning by subtracting a Sol 910 night image without LED returned this image ![]() then RGB channel-wise histo stretch returned this one: ![]() Subtraction of the histo stretched white LED image from the cleaned and histo stretched uv LED image returned this image: ![]() Histo stretch of the difference image returned this result: ![]() In the latter image I wasn't able to indentify fluorescence or phosphorescence uniquely. Most variations are probably due to shadows and slightly different positions of the LEDs (my preliminary interpretation). |
